UniOp eTOP30 - Graphic Display HMI

The UniOp eTOP30 is a versatile and robust Human Machine Interface (HMI) designed to meet the demanding requirements of power industry, petrochemical plants, and general automation sectors. Engineered with advanced technical features, the eTOP30 excels in providing reliable and efficient control and monitoring solutions in complex industrial environments. At the core of the UniOp eTOP30 is its high-resolution color display, which offers clear visualization of process data and alarms. It supports a wide range of input/output (I/O) capacities, enabling seamless integration with various industrial controllers and devices. The eTOP30 typically features multiple serial communication ports supporting protocols such as Modbus RTU and ASCII, which allow for flexible connectivity options. Its input capacity includes support for up to 48 digital inputs and outputs, alongside analog I/O channels, which facilitate precise control and monitoring of industrial processes. This enhanced I/O capability makes it suitable for applications requiring extensive data acquisition and control, such as in power substations or petrochemical processing units. Durability is a hallmark of the UniOp eTOP30. Built to withstand harsh industrial conditions, it boasts a rugged enclosure with an IP65-rated front panel, ensuring protection against dust, water, and other contaminants frequently encountered in outdoor or heavy industrial environments. The device’s operating temperature range extends from -20°C to 60°C, making it reliable in extreme temperature conditions often seen in power generation plants or chemical processing facilities. 


Moreover, the eTOP30 offers rapid response times and high processing speed, ensuring real-time data processing and smooth operation without lag, which is critical for maintaining process safety and efficiency. In real-world scenarios, the UniOp eTOP30 excels in power industry applications such as substation automation, where real-time monitoring of voltage, current, and breaker status is crucial. In petrochemical plants, it provides intuitive process visualization and alarm management to ensure safe and continuous operation of reactors, distillation columns, and pipelines. For general automation, the eTOP30 delivers effective human-machine communication for manufacturing lines, packaging systems, and material handling equipment, improving operational productivity and reducing downtime.
